what is container unloading?

Container unloading is the process of removing cargo from a container. Industry professionals also call it ‘container destuffing', ‘unstuffing’, 'devanning containers' or ‘container stripping’.

There are two main types of container unloading:

  • Full container load (FCL) destuffing: which entails unloading a container with goods destined for a single consignee;
  • Less than container load (LCL), which involves coordinating and segregating cargo carefully from a single container to several consignees and is more complex and time-consuming because of the cargo’s mixed nature.

What is the container unloading process?

Traditionally, operators perform container unloading manually. Container unloading itself is relatively straightforward:

  1. the container is placed securely in a designated unloading area, usually a loading dock. Personnel document the shipment’s arrival at the destination port, conduct integrity checks on customs seals and prepare equipment to unload the container;
  2. personnel remove the seals and open the container doors. Following a pre-planned order, they remove the goods carefully, using a ‘last in first out’ approach, with heavy loads being removed last because they were loaded first into the container. Often, personnel use pallet jacks and straps to unload the cargo manually;
  3. personnel check the goods against the shipping manifest (or packing list) to make sure all the listed items are there and undamaged. They then sort and prepare them. This can mean staging the goods for customs clearance and transportation to customers’ premises, freight container stations or warehouses;
  4. personnel inspect the container for damage before returning it for further use. They’ll remove any debris or packing material so the container is clean for the next shipping operation.

how much does container unloading cost?

The cost of unloading a container is not simply the hourly cost of the people performing the work. To understand whether a new unloading solution makes financial sense, businesses should calculate the total cost of their existing process.

Outsourcing the process to a professional unloading company costs approximately:

  • between £250 and £350 for a loose-loaded ISO container (20-40 ft);
  • between £150 and £250 for a pallet-loaded ISO container (20-40 ft).

Manual unloading can take 1-2 hours. Any additional waiting time beyond three hours can incur charges or around £55 or more per extra hour.

Container unloading equipment costs

Container unloading equipment can cost the following, with the upper end of the price range being for heavy-duty equipment:

  • Bolt cutters: £25 to £100
  • Pallet truck: approximately £400 to £2,000+
  • Forklift truck: £3,500 to £30,000+
  • Forklift ramp: £300 to £13,000+

the cost of container unloading in logistics operations

Some operators don’t realise just how costly manual container unloading is for their business. The true costs of container unloading are:

  • labour costs and workforce inefficiencies: manual labour is slow, inconsistent and workers are prone to fatigue. A team of workers unloading cargo manually costs substantially more in wages and takes much longer to perform the task than an automated solution. The financial impact of unsafe or physically demanding processes can extend beyond the immediate incident. HSE estimates that work-related ill health and workplace injuries resulted in 40.1 million working days lost across Great Britain in 2024/25;
  • time delays and demurrage charges: manual loading can cause orders to back up, leading to delays and potential demurrage charges as cargo fails to leave the port storage area on time. Delays in container loading and unloading can lead directly to severe financial penalties. The US Federal Maritime Commission reports that nine major ocean carriers collected roughly $15.4 billion in detention and demurrage charges between April 2020 and March 2025. While these charges vary by carrier and contract, they underscore the immense financial risk when slow handling causes containers to sit beyond their allotted free time;
  • product damage and handling risks: manual handling increases the risk of product damage and injuries. Personnel are more likely to stack goods incorrectly, drop them or mishandle them in their rush to meet targets. Forklift container unloading carries significant risk, too, and the damage not only incurs a financial cost but can also harm business relationships and customers’ faith in the business. Handling, lifting or carrying accounted for 17% of employer-reported non-fatal workplace injuries in Great Britain in 2024/25;
  • equipment limitations and bottlenecks: unloading containers manually often creates workflow disruptions and delays in sorting, staging and processing goods. The results: congestion and missed deadlines. The use of equipment such as forklifts has limitations, including the space required for manoeuvring, limited visibility, the need for an operator, safety hazards and the slow speed of forklifts themselves

How to calculate your current container unloading cost

  • Cost per container = Labour + equipment + delays + damage + additional charges
  • Annual unloading cost = Average cost per container × Number of containers unloaded per year
  • Potential annual saving = Current annual unloading cost - Estimated annual cost using the new solution
  • Payback period = Total investment ÷ Annual cost savings

*This calculation provides an initial estimate. Businesses should also consider maintenance, energy, training, installation and the expected lifespan of the equipment when calculating total cost of ownership.

types of container unloading equipment explained

Fortunately, logistics personnel can lighten loads with different types of container unloading equipment.

Forklift container unloading

When using forklifts, operators must align the forklift with the container entrance for smooth entry and, to ensure maximum support, position it correctly under the load. The forklift must set the load down safely, in line with best practices, so that it can be prepared for transportation.

Hydraulic container unloading

Hydraulic container unloading, is an efficient alternative. The system consists of a skate train, a hydraulic pump and a galvanised steel track placed on the container and loading dock floors.

The pump raises the skate, lifting the load clear of the platform deck so operators can transfer the load easily from the container. This type of specialised equipment can load and unload different types of cargo, including heavy, bulky, long and complex items up to 28 tonnes. It can complete the loading process within 15 minutes.

how to reduce container unloading time and increase efficiency

Cargo unloading processes can be slow, but there are ways to reduce unloading times and increase efficiency.

Optimise the process

  • Streamline the process: assess your current unloading processes and identify weak spots and (potential) bottlenecks. Communicate with carriers, shippers and logistics teams, and schedule appointments to manage workflows and reduce idle time.
  • Organise unloading: prioritise critical shipments, group similar items together for bulk container unloading and keep pathways clear to improve overall freight unloading productivity.
  • Train staff regularly: educate staff on cargo unloading best practices, prioritising loads and managing time during cargo handling. Train them to use any necessary technology or machinery correctly.
  • Equip the premises with the right tools: high-quality unloading equipment, such as one of our container loading solutions, pallet jacks and conveyors can accelerate unloading.

Improve the dockside

  • Install dock levellers: Matching platforms to vehicle heights is one of the most straightforward steps you can take so that forklifts and other cargo handling equipment move seamlessly. Uneven platforms hamper movement, delay processes and pose safety risks. Dock levellers allow smooth, safe cargo transfer by bridging the gap between the container and the unloading area.
  • Prioritise for safety: safe container unloading is essential, so keep the dockside clean and clutter-free. Separate pedestrian and forklift traffic to reduce accidents. Perform regular preventive maintenance on container unloading equipment, which also minimises downtime.
  • Avoid bottlenecks and restrict truck directional flow: Vehicles moving around everywhere create congestion and bottlenecks. Trucks block each other and cause delays. Restrict truck directional flow and minimise the need for turning so container unloading flows.
Container Loading 2 Dk

Reduce idle time and congestion

  • Organise space: create designated storage zones for sorting and placing goods easily, and staging zones for temporary storage or sorting before moving them to their final storage area.
  • Use vertical racking and shelving: making use of vertical space vertically optimises the warehouse, minimises congestion and makes the premises safer to conduct loading and unloading in.
  • Improve port infrastructure: creating new terminals, widening shipping channels and other infrastructure improvements increase port capacity and make port container handling feel much less crowded for efficient cargo handling.

safe container unloading practices and risk reduction

Unloading shipping containers is riddled with safety risks, but there are several safe container unloading practices you can follow to reduce the risk:

  • prepare the site and equipment to receive and unload the container safely;
  • plan unloading;
  • avoid rushing unloading;
  • consult with other workers on the safest way to unload the container;
  • remove any obstructions.

HSE estimates that injuries and ill health arising from current working conditions cost Great Britain £22.9 billion in 2023/24. While an individual business will have its own exposure, the figure demonstrates why safety should be considered when evaluating the total cost of a manual handling process.

frequently asked questions (FAQ)

How to unload a container without a loading dock?

A container can be unloaded without a traditional loading dock using equipment such as mobile ramps or Hydraulic Container Unloading Systems. The most suitable method depends on the cargo type, load weight, container height and available space. For regular container handling, a dedicated unloading solution can provide a safer and more efficient way to transfer goods without relying on a fixed loading dock.

How to unload a container without a forklift?

Containers can be unloaded without a forklift using equipment such as a Hydraulic Container Unloading Systems, or specialised loading and unloading equipment, depending on the cargo. The most suitable method will depend on factors including whether the goods are palletised or loose-loaded, their weight and the available unloading area.

How long does it take to unload a container?

The time it takes to unload a container depends on factors including the type of cargo, how it is loaded, the number of available workers and the equipment used. Manual unloading can take several hours, particularly for loose-loaded cargo, while palletised goods and specialised unloading systems, like our Hydraulic Container Unloading System, can unload a full container in 15 minutes.

How to safely unload containers with limited staff?

Businesses with limited staff can improve safety by reducing the amount of manual handling required during unloading. This may involve using equipment that supports the movement of cargo, such as a Hydraulic Container Unloading System. Planning the unloading sequence in advance and ensuring workers have appropriate training. Keeping the unloading area clear, securing the container and using equipment suited to the load can allow smaller teams to work more efficiently.

What are the most efficient methods for container unloading?

The most efficient container unloading method depends on the cargo, container volume and operational requirements. Manual unloading may suit low-volume or irregular operations, while forklifts can efficiently handle palletised loads. Hydraulic Container Unloading systems can improve throughput by reducing manual handling and speeding up the movement of goods. The best option is the one that provides the right balance between investment, operating costs, unloading speed and safety.
